New Orleans Pothole Problem Persists: Residents Frustrated by Unrepaired Road Hazards New Orleans, LA – A seemingly simple pothole on Esplanade Avenue has become a symbol of the city's ongoing struggle with road maintenance. A viral TikTok video from December 2023 showed people swimming and drinking beer in a massive pothole. "It was like a pool," one resident recalled. "People were actually using it as a swimming hole." The video garnered significant attention, highlighting the neglect of the city's infrastructure. Fast forward to May 2025, and the situation remains unchanged. A recent follow-up video by the same TikTok creator shows the pothole is not only still there but has worsened. "It's way worse than it was last year," the creator stated, driving past the now-larger pothole. To add insult to injury, another large pothole has appeared just a short distance away. The persistence of these potholes raises concerns about public safety and the effectiveness of the city's road repair programs. The lack of repair, despite the viral attention the initial incident received, underscores the frustration felt by many New Orleans residents who contend with similar issues across the city. The city's Department of Public Works has not yet commented on the situation.
